Preserving information consistency throughout the CAST Engineering Dashboard imposes limitations on Systems, Applications, and Modules organization updates.
Options and constraints
Systems, Applications, and Modules organization handling options are:
- Module grouping into Application
- Application grouping into System
- Systems, Applications, and user-defined Modules can be renamed (requiring an CAST Engineering Dashboard reload to refresh the cached data)
- Names have to be unique
- Especially Module names as they are the mapping key in Background Facts and Business Value Metric upload
- Systems, Applications, and Modules organization can be enriched with new branches and leaves over time
- Systems, Applications, and Modules organization can be severed from branches and leaves over time
- Systems and Applications are "deleted", along with their history
- Modules are only "deprecated" as they still exist in past Application assessment
- As soon as some assessment results are generated, the moving of branches and leaves within the Systems, Applications, and Modules organization over time is not possible (it is still possible up until a Snapshot is computed).
Warning:
- Module node name updates impact Background facts and Business Value import (as it has to map to names)
